1847 - Founded by Werner Siemens (1816-1892) with his brother, Johann George Halske as Siemens & Halske Telegraph Construction Company in Berlin.

1890 - Werner von Siemens handed the company over to his brother, Carl, and his sons, Arnold and Wilhelm.

1897 - Siemens & Halske became a stock corporation as Siemens & Halske AG.

1903 - Parts of Siemens & Halske AG were merged with Schuckert & Co. to become Siemens-Schuckert.

1919 - Siemens & Halske AG, along with two other companies, formed Osram lightbulb company.

1966 - Siemens & Halske AG, Siemens-Shuckert and Siemens-Reiniger-Werke merged to form Siemens AG.
